Navigating the Market: How to Safely Buy Weight Loss Drugs in Italy
Over the last few years, the landscape of obesity management has shifted significantly. With the arrival of sophisticated pharmacological treatments, individuals battling with weight management have more choices than ever previously. Italy is no exception to this international pattern, seeing a rise in demand for medically shown weight-loss medications.
Nevertheless, buying these medications involves browsing a stringent regulative environment. Whether a resident or a visitor, understanding how to legally, securely, and successfully access weight reduction drugs in Italy is vital for health and security.
Comprehending Weight Loss Medications Available in Italy
Not all weight loss drugs authorized in other countries are offered or legal in Italy. The Italian Medicines Agency (Agenzia Italiana Prodotti Per La Gestione Del Peso In Italia Farmaco, or AIFA) strictly controls which pharmaceutical treatments can be prescribed and given.
Typically, weight-loss drugs fall into a few main classifications:
- GLP-1 Receptor Agonists and Dual GIP/GLP -1 Receptor Agonists: Originally developed for type 2 diabetes, medications like liraglutide and semaglutide have revealed amazing effectiveness in promoting significant weight loss by regulating cravings and slowing gastric emptying.
- Lipase Inhibitors: Medications like orlistat work in your area in the gut to prevent the body from soaking up a part of the dietary fat consumed.
- Mix Therapies: Drugs that combine agents to target brain centers managing cravings and yearnings (though accessibility differs considerably by country).

The Legal and Safe Process to Obtain Prescriptions
In Italy, client security is critical, indicating that powerful weight-loss medications can not just be gotten off a drug store shelf. A structured medical evaluation is needed.
Step 1: Consult a Healthcare Professional
The journey must begin with a check out to a competent medical doctor. This can be a basic practitioner (Medico di Medicina Generale), an endocrinologist, or a bariatric expert.
- The doctor will examine the patient's Body Mass Index (BMI).
- They will evaluate for underlying health conditions such as type 2 diabetes, high blood pressure, or heart disease.
- Blood tests and metabolic panels are typically bought to ensure the medication is safe for the person.

Step 3: Visit a Local Pharmacy (Farmacia)
With the prescription in hand, clients go to a brick-and-mortar Italian drug store, identifiable by the radiant green cross. Pharmacists will give the medication and offer therapy on storage (lots of peptide injections require refrigeration) and administration.
The Dangers of Buying Weight Loss Drugs Online Without a Prescription
With the rising popularity of anti-obesity medications, the web has unfortunately flooded with illicit online pharmacies claiming to sell these drugs without a prescription. Acquiring medications through these channels in Italy poses serious threats:
- Counterfeit Products: Illicit labs often produce phony variations of popular pens, which might contain incorrect does, harmful contaminants, or no active components.
- Lack of Medical Supervision: Taking potent metabolic drugs without standard blood work and physician oversight can cause extreme, unmanaged side results.

Tips for Managing Costs and Insurance Coverage
The cost of contemporary weight-loss pharmacotherapy can be considerable. Comprehending how the Italian healthcare system manages these expenses is essential for monetary preparation.
- National Health Service (SSN) Coverage: In Italy, the SSN (Servizio Sanitario Nazionale) may cover particular diabetes medications, however protection for obesity-specific signs differs by region (regione) and particular drug approvals. Clients should consult their physician relating to regional health insurance (piani terapeutici).
- Out-of-Pocket Expenses: For medications prescribed purely for cosmetic weight loss or when not covered by local health insurance, patients pay entirely expense. Rates vary depending upon the particular pharmacy and dose.
- Tax Deductions: In Italy, medical expenditures, consisting of prescription medications acquired at pharmacies, can typically be subtracted from annual earnings taxes (IRPEF) offered the patient keeps the detailed receipt (scontrino parlante) including their tax code (codice fiscale).
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Can travelers buy weight-loss drugs in Italy with a foreign prescription?
Normally, Italian pharmacies can not dispense prescription-only medications utilizing a prescription provided by a medical professional outside the European Union. EU prescriptions are in some cases honored, but it is heavily reliant on the pharmacist's discretion and the particular drug. Tourists are advised to speak with an Italian physician for a regional prescription if they lack medication.
2. Can I buy Ozempic or Wegovy non-prescription in Italy?
No. Semaglutide, whether branded for diabetes (Ozempic) or weight loss (Wegovy), is strictly a prescription-only medication in Italy. Selling it without a prescription is unlawful and punishable by law.
3. Are weight-loss medications covered by the Italian public healthcare system?
Coverage depends heavily on the specific medication, the intensity of the client's condition (such as extreme obesity paired with metabolic syndrome), and regional health care guidelines. Many patients spend for these treatments independently.
4. What should I do if I experience negative effects from my weight-loss medication?
If you experience adverse results-- such as extreme queasiness, vomiting, or stomach pain-- you must right away call the prescribing doctor. Do not abruptly stop taking particular medications without professional medical advice. Adverse effects can also be reported to AIFA through official pharmacovigilance channels.
